At a certain temperature, the saturated solution of a substance evaporates part of the solvent at a constant temperature, and solute precipitates out, then the remaining solution () A. becoming an unsaturated solution B. Increased mass fraction of solute in solution C. Solute mass fraction of solution unchanged D. Reduction of solute mass fraction in solution

In the saturated solution of a substance, after a part of the solvent is evaporated under the condition of constant temperature, there is crystal precipitation, because the solubility of the substance is constant, there is crystal in the solution, the remaining solution is still saturated solution, and the mass fraction of solute is constant;
Answer: C
